Grant Cardone is an American entrepreneur, author, motivational speaker and also real estate investor. Grant Cardone is also a professional sales trainer and a speaker on leadership, social media and finance.

He has written eight business books, runs thirteen business programs, and is also CEO of seven private companies. He controls the worth of $4 Billion. Cardone has written multiple books on sales, business and personal development. For example: “The 10X Rule”, “Sell or Be Sold”, and “If You’re Not First”, “You’re Last”.

He is a successful real estate investor, he also owns a multi-million dollar real estate portfolio and he often shares his ideas through books, events and courses. Cardone created Cardone Capital in 2016 to invest in and manage multi-family residential real estate.

Grant Cardone Net Worth 2024

Grant Cardone net worth is estimated to be $600 million. According to Nasdaq, Cardone became a millionaire by the age of thirty, and he hasn't looked back. Such an amazing amount is the result of a broad plan that includes best-selling books, successful real estate businesses, and effective sales training programs.

With a multibillion-dollar real estate portfolio that reaches $4 billion, Cardone Capital is a proud owner. Their Cardone Real Estate Acquisitions business focuses on identifying and buying properties mostly for rental income. It was started in 1995 and initially focused on multi-family homes around the United States.

Real Estate Empire

Cardone created Cardone Capital, an investment company, and used it to build an empire in real estate on his own. According to his biography, the company has been involved in real estate transactions worth billions of dollars and currently owns residential properties in the United States valued at about $2.7 billion. There has been no independent validation of that number.

Early Life

On March 21, 1958, Grant Cardone was born in Lake Charles, Louisiana. Concetta Neil Cardone and Curtis Louis Cardone were his parents. Grant is the fourth of five children, with a twin brother named Gary.

He completed his education at Lake Charles LaGrange High School and McNeese State University in 1981. In the end, he would receive the 2010 Distinguished Alumnus Award from McNeese State University.

Cardone graduated in 1976 from Lake Charles LaGrange High School. He continued to attend McNeese State University until 1981 when he graduated with a Bachelor of Science in Accounting. He received an award in 2010 with the McNeese State University Distinguished Alumnus Award, which is given to exceptional students.

Professional career

Grant decided not to continue in his initial career in accounting after graduating from college, and in 1987 he moved to Chicago, Illinois, to work for a sales training organization. After travelling the country, he lived in Houston, Texas, for five years, La Jolla, California, for twelve years, and Los Angeles, at last.

Grant became addicted to drugs along the way and checked himself into treatment at the age of 25. After he got out of rehab, he became a millionaire in five years. He started making his money while selling cars, and he ultimately moved to the position of CEO of Freedom Motorsports Group Inc.

The 2011 National Geographic reality series "Turnaround King" was developed with his help. In addition to helping train salespeople from auto dealerships, Grant is the owner of Cardone Enterprises, Cardone Acquisitions, Cardone Training Technologies, and The Cardone Group.
